Lars Corneliussen commented on NPANDAY-595:
-------------------------------------------

I implemented the filter-based approach. Also did some other enhancements.

PDB is by default disabled for init and compile, but enabled for tests.

The various application packaging mojos should also be provided with the option 
to disable/enable pdb resolving.
Maybe it is a good point in time to also implement the vsdocs-resolver and 
handle those paralelly. We can also have a "ComplementaryArtifactFilter" which 
skips complementary resolved types...
